.introLink {	font-family: verdana;	font-size: 12px;	line-height: 14px;	font-weight: bold;	color: #dd760f;	text-decoration: underline;}.introLink:hover {	text-decoration: none;}.assurancesSpacerVert {	background-color: #cfcfcb;}.assurancesNiveau1Description {	font-family: verdana;	font-size: 11px;	line-height: 13px;	font-weight: bold;	color: #dd760f;	padding: 0px 10px 0px 10px;	background-image: url(images_shared/fnd_assurances_titres.jpg);}.assurancesNiveau2Td {	background-color: #f7f7f5;}.assurancesNiveau2Description {	font-size: 11px;	line-height: 13px;	font-family: verdana;	color: #6e3b07;}.assurancesNiveau2ColAC {	font-size: 10px;	line-height: 12px;	text-align: center;	background-color: #f7f7f5;	font-family: verdana;	color: #6e3b07;}.assurancesNiveau2ColBD {	font-size: 10px;	line-height: 12px;	text-align: center;	background-color: #eeeeea;	font-family: verdana;	color: #6e3b07;}.assurancesNiveau3Td {	background-color: #fcfcfb;}.assurancesNiveau3Description {	text-align: right;	font-family: verdana;	font-size: 10px;	line-height: 12px;	color: #063749;}.assurancesNiveau3ColAC {	text-align: center;	background-color: #fcfcfb;	font-family: verdana;	font-size: 10px;	line-height: 12px;	color: #063749;}.assurancesNiveau3ColBD {	text-align: center;	background-color: #f9f9f6;	font-family: verdana;	font-size: 10px;	line-height: 12px;	color: #063749;}.assurancesIntro {	font-family: verdana;	font-size: 11px;	line-height: 13px;	font-weight: bold;	color: #063749;}.assurancesNote {	font-family: verdana;	font-size: 11px;	line-height: 13px;	color: #a12605;}